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
651404 43868466030 60577678 593100496 95404489628
018 84442281 186070244
018 84442281 186070244
10 23192813576 3420631190 46 04602533
All about undefined
Interested in learning more?
018 84442281 186070244
10 23192813576 3420631190 46 04602533
See more
818554714 066 976
4280444 346482 196427121
See more
832337 33546625 3179366206
870 518 38009331223
See more